The ingredients needed to make Chocolate Peanut Butter Granola Apple Bites:
  1. Make ready 1 eating apple
  2. Get 1 tbsp peanut butter
  3. Prepare 1 tbsp gluten free granola
  4. Take 2 squares dairy free dark chocolate melted

Drizzle wedges with melted chocolate, set on a large platter and serve. Carefully coat the tops of the apple wedges in peanut butter. Next, sprinkle the top of each wedge evenly with granola. Drizzle the top with chocolate syrup.

Instructions to make Chocolate Peanut Butter Granola Apple Bites:
  1. Core the apple - Cut into slices so you have apple rings
  2. Spread with the peanut butter and sprinkle on the granola - Drizzle over the melted dairy free dark chocolate
